Colombia’s president opens Ayacucho tramway

Listen to this article

The President of Colombia, Juan Manuel Santos, attended the formal opening of the Ayacucho tram line in Medellin.

At a ceremony on October 20, the line was officially launched. Although, it has been operating a trial service since October 15.

The 4.3-kilometre line includes nine stations and is expected to transport 85,000 passengers each day.

NTL, which is 51 per cent owned by Alstom, has supplied 12 Translohr STE5 trams, similar to those operating in France and Spain, for Medellin. The 39-metre trams have been engineered to cope with the system’s 12 per cent gradients.
